We are looking for a Data Analytics Manager for our European Analytics Team. The Data Analytics Manager is a new role in our growing Europe Analytics Team, which sits within a wider European team based in Oakham, Rutland and Mettlach, Germany. This role is responsible for leading a team of analysts to power data driven decision making, drive efficiency and elevate customer understanding across the business. A balance of team management and individual contributions will be required to be successful in this role. You will manage a combination of insight service provision and data product building to drive efficiency across the business and power intelligent decision making.
What You Can Expect From The Role:
- Hands‑on analysis of customer, sales and product data using a variety of technical tools (SQL, R, Python, Power BI etc.) to create timely, relevant and actionable insights.
- Continuously enhance our understanding of our customers through examining customer behaviour data, spotting emerging trends and market influences.
- Build sophisticated data products to enable quicker, smarter decision making and ensure we have ongoing solutions to business challenges.
- Identify opportunities for standardisation.
